Vincennes students win national competition
VINCENNES, Ind. (WTWO/WAWV) — A local high school in Vincennes finished first in the nation in mathematical modeling during a national competition at the end of June. The Vincennes' Rivet High School academic team participated in a competition called TEAMS which stands for tests of engineering, aptitude, mathematics, and science.
